Transaction 684f150ce0816f4265788c9b3bbbafdbc4aa60220c5110290e4e3cc384f69785

block
81dc53cacf48a3ddadb2a2ed2431a0c92afb8b25703a143d1689ff7fe068c320

1 Input

2 Outputs